ó
—¨ídc           @   ss   d  d l  m Z d  d l m Z e rY d  d l m Z d  d l m Z d  d l m	 Z	 n  d e f d „  ƒ  YZ
 d S(	   iÿÿÿÿ(   t   AbstractDistribution(   t   MYPY_CHECK_RUNNING(   t   Optional(   t   Distribution(   t   PackageFindert   InstalledDistributionc           B   s    e  Z d  Z d „  Z d „  Z RS(   sˆ   Represents an installed package.

    This does not need any preparation as the required information has already
    been computed.
    c         C   s
   |  j  j S(   N(   t   reqt   satisfied_by(   t   self(    (    sv   /var/www/when_to_call/project-create-wtc-api/venv/lib/python2.7/site-packages/pip/_internal/distributions/installed.pyt   get_pkg_resources_distribution   s    c         C   s   d  S(   N(    (   R   t   findert   build_isolation(    (    sv   /var/www/when_to_call/project-create-wtc-api/venv/lib/python2.7/site-packages/pip/_internal/distributions/installed.pyt   prepare_distribution_metadata   s    (   t   __name__t
   __module__t   __doc__R	   R   (    (    (    sv   /var/www/when_to_call/project-create-wtc-api/venv/lib/python2.7/site-packages/pip/_internal/distributions/installed.pyR      s   	N(   t    pip._internal.distributions.baseR    t   pip._internal.utils.typingR   t   typingR   t   pip._vendor.pkg_resourcesR   t"   pip._internal.index.package_finderR   R   (    (    (    sv   /var/www/when_to_call/project-create-wtc-api/venv/lib/python2.7/site-packages/pip/_internal/distributions/installed.pyt   <module>   s   